In the prophetic vision of a peaceful future, the image of each person sitting under their own vine and fig tree represents a life of peace, security, and prosperity. This imagery is deeply rooted in the agrarian society of ancient Israel, where vines and fig trees were symbols of abundance and well-being. The promise that no one will make them afraid highlights a future free from fear and oppression, a stark contrast to the turmoil and uncertainty often faced by the people of Israel.
This message is a powerful assurance from God, emphasizing His sovereignty and the fulfillment of His promises. It reflects the ultimate hope for a world where individuals can live in harmony, enjoying the fruits of their labor without the threat of danger. The phrase "for the Lord Almighty has spoken" underscores the certainty of this promise, as it is backed by the authority and power of God Himself. This vision resonates with the universal human desire for peace and security, reminding believers that God is the source of true peace and protection.
